After returning from a “fact finding” trip to Alaska and the Rocky Mountains, House Minority Leader John Boehner and other House Republicans unveiled yet another drill-everywhere bill on the steps of the Capitol yesterday. They were greeted by an equal number of citizens urging them to move towards a clean energy future, rather than technology of the past. Rep. Boehner and other House Republicans were unable to land in Kaktovik, AK or see the Arctic National Wildlife Refuge on their recent trip to Alaska due to fog. But it wouldn’t have made any difference -- before leaving, Boehner said he thought they wouldn’t see any wildlife since it was just an Arctic desert anyway. Rep. Boehner didn't even have the courtesy to respond to an invitation from the Gwich'in Nation who consider the coastal plain of the Refuge "the Sacred Place Where Life Begins."
